Stackers at the Gravenhurst Antique Boat Show
I'd seen pictures of the Chrysler stacker of course, but had never seen one in person before. The owner just bought it recently from the son of the original motor. It seems the motor had not been run since 1971 or so, but it apparently started easily and made a lot of noise. Fun to look at, but I don't know that it would work on anything but a vintage tunnel.
My thinking is that the stacker Chris Craft motor was a non OEM conversion. I regret not asking about it. There was too much to took at in the time I allowed.
